Protiviti is looking for a Technology Consulting Senior Manager to join our growing Infrastructure, Cloud, & Security Engineering team.

Requirements

  • Recent hands-on design, deployment, and/or administration experience in Windows Server and Linux systems administration
  • Working familiarity with Unix variants and Mac OS; prior administration experience a plus
  • Working familiarity with Amazon AWS, Microsoft Azure and other IaaS providers preferred
  • Strong enterprise networking design, deployment, and/or administration experience
  • Working familiarity with enterprise-class vendors and product lines strongly preferred (e.g. Cisco, Cisco Meraki, HPE/Aruba, Juniper, Extreme, Brocade)
  • Working familiarity with enterprise-class network security appliance vendors and product lines strongly preferred (e.g. Cisco, Cisco Meraki, Palo Alto, Fortinet)
  • Working familiarity with SMB/”prosumer” vendors and product lines a plus (e.g. Ubiquiti/UBNT, SonicWall, Mikrotik) a plus
  • Working familiarity with load balancers, VPN appliances/concentrators a plus
  • In depth understanding of current enterprise design patterns and norms for basic networking capabilities/concepts (e.g. TCP/IP, DNS, DHCP, VLAN segmentation, routing and switching, wireless)
  • Strong familiarity with SMB and entry-level on premises computing infrastructure technologies
  • Working familiarity with multiple server hardware vendors and associated management tools/platforms (e.g. Dell, HPE, Cisco, SuperMicro) strongly preferred
  • Working familiarity with hypervisor platforms (e.g. VMware vSphere/ESXi, Microsoft Hyper-V, Nutanix AHV, or others) strongly preferred
  • Strong familiarity with enterprise storage
  • Working familiarity with DAS, SAN, and NAS/filer solutions
  • Working understanding of contemporary network storage protocols and interconnect methods (e.g. iSCSI, CIFS, FibreChannel, NFS)
  • Strong familiarity with basic on premises infrastructure management best practices
  • Rack management
  • Power and cooling demand management
  • Physical security
  • Strong familiarity with scripting for administrative, auditing, and other operational purposes
  • Prior experience writing PowerShell, Python, BASH/other Linux shell scripts strongly preferred
  • Prior experience with typical infrastructure and server/endpoint management toolsets
  • Performance and capacity management tools
  • Endpoint management / RMM platforms
  • Patch and vulnerability management tools
  • Log and event aggregation technologies (Kafka, SIEMs, Splunk, etc.)
  • Prior experience with capacity planning, VM/server “right-sizing”, performance analysis
  • Prior experience and ownership designing server, network, application solutions through deployment phase
  • Prior experience administrating Office 365 services
  • Prior experience administrating Microsoft Exchange, Google G Suite/Workspace is a plus
  • Experience designing, building, or remediating an environment to meet specific regulatory requirements such as PCI-DSS, CMMC, NIST 800-53.
  • Prior experience translating undocumented systems / applications / operating procedures into usable documentation is absolutely necessary; Ability to update or create visualizations of dependency maps or architecture overviews is a must
  • Prior experience with integration of IT systems in a post-merger/acquisition environment
  • Prior experience with application rationalization / dependency mapping exercises
  • Prior experience designing, implementing, or administrating backup and replication/continuity solutions for server, storage, and application infrastructure
  • Familiarity with typical project management methods (Agile, Waterfall, etc.)
  • Prior experience translating business requirements (e.g. compliance controls, vendor / business partner requirements) into technical configurations / solutions
  • Prior experience dealing with third party hardware/software/service vendors preferred
  • Prior experience translating business continuity / disaster recovery requirements into technical solution designs preferred
  • Establishing and cultivating business relationships and a professional network, including with senior executives.
  • Successfully pursuing business development opportunities and identifying and implementing strategies to obtain new work or clientele.
  • Bachelor’s degree in (Comp Sci, Comp Eng, Networking) or relevant field, or equivalent experience delivering technology or consulting solutions.
  • 7+ years working in professional services or related fields.
  • Excellent verbal and written English
  • Comfortable collaborating with key business executives, system/application owners or stakeholders in group conversation or direct interview contexts
  • Ability to rapidly shift between planning / design work and practical execution (“hands on keyboard” tasks for discovery or implementation) is an absolute necessity
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ills required
